Advanced Practice Provider

Valley ENT
Visalia, CA

Job Description

Job Description

Salary: 135,000

Advanced Practice Provider (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ner)

Specialty Practice Valley ENT

$10,000 Sign-On Bonus Available

Valley ENT is seeking a motivated and career-oriented Advanced Practice Provider (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ner) to join our growing ENT practice. This is an outstanding opportunity for a provider seeking strong mentorship, procedural training, long-term career development, and exceptional work-life balance within a collaborative private practice setting.

Whether you are an experienced APP or looking to transition into a specialty practice, we are committed to helping you build expertise and confidence through a structured and supportive training program.

Position Overview

The APP will primarily practice in our Visalia clinic, caring for both adult and pediatric patients in well-established ENT practice.

Our practice is known for its positive culture, approachable physician leadership, and team-oriented environment. We believe in providing the support and resources necessary for providers to thrive professionally while maintaining a healthy balance outside of work.

Training & Mentorship

We are passionate about developing excellent specialty providers and invest significantly in training and mentorship.

Our onboarding program includes:

  • Dedicated physician mentorship and ongoing clinical support
  • Comprehensive training during the first several months
  • Weekly provider-led educational sessions and case discussions
  • CME support, including opportunities to attend national conferences
  • Gradual patient ramp-up designed to build confidence and clinical excellence
  • Hands-on procedural training with increasing autonomy over time
  • A collaborative learning environment where questions and growth are encouraged

Previous ENT experience is not required. We welcome candidates who demonstrate professionalism, curiosity, adaptability, and a genuine interest in developing expertise within a specialty practice.

Compensation & Professional Growth

We offer competitive compensation throughout the credentialing and training period, along with a clear pathway for professional and financial growth.

Compensation highlights include:

  • 10,000 Sign-On Bonus
  • Competitive starting salary during training and credentialing
  • Income potential exceeding $150,000 annually following successful completion of onboarding and credentialing
  • Continued compensation growth as clinical experience, efficiency, procedural skills, and patient volume increase
  • Many providers achieve compensation in the range of approximately $175,000 annually within the first 1218 months as they become increasingly comfortable managing a robust clinic schedule
  • Long-term income potential exceeding $200,000 annually with continued professional development and procedural proficiency

Our goal is to create an environment where providers can steadily expand their skills, autonomy, and earning potential while delivering outstanding patient care.

Why Valley ENT?

We view this position as more than a jobit is an opportunity to build a rewarding specialty career within a supportive practice that values professional growth and long-term success.

We are looking for providers who are excited about learning, developing advanced clinical skills, and becoming an integral part of a thriving team. In return, we offer meaningful mentorship, career advancement opportunities, and a workplace culture built on collaboration, respect, and mutual investment.

Schedule & Lifestyle

  • Full-time and part-time opportunities available
  • Excellent work-life balance
  • Predictable outpatient schedule
  • Primarily 10-hour clinic shifts
  • Supportive and collegial provider team
  • Established patient base with consistent clinical volume

Benefits

  • Health, Dental, and Vision Insurance
  • Paid Time Off (Vacation, Sick Leave, and Holidays)
  • Life Insurance
  • 401(k) with Profit Sharing
  • CME allowance and conference opportunities

Qualifications

Required

  • Master's Degree from an accredited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ner program
  • Current California license (or ability to obtain)
  • National certification as a PA or NP
  • Ability to practice independently with appropriate physician collaboration

Preferred

  • Adult and pediatric clinical experience
  • Interest in procedures and specialty medicine
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• Desire for ongoing professional development and long-term career growth

Job Type

Full-Time or Part-Time

Work Location

In Person Visalia, California
